Regione Veneto: €1.5 million for audiovisual production

As part of the Programma Operativo Complementare 2014-2020, in alignment with POR FESR 2014-2020, the Regione del Veneto has announced a call for bids in support of film and audio-visual productions in the region.

The goal is to:  strengthen and improve the market competitivity of businesses in the cinema industry and encourage their activity, also by increasing collaboration with foreign producers, and to promote awareness of the Region’s artistic and natural heritage and local traditional products.

With an endowment of €1.5 million, the call targets Italian and international production companies that intend to shoot all or part of their audio-visual works in the Veneto region, for categories including:  Fiction (TV series or feature-length dramas), Animation, Doc (documentaries), Short (short films) and XR (Extended Reality), i.e. VR (Virtual Reality), AR (Augmented Reality) and MR (Mixed Reality).

The maximum individual contribution available is €200k for Fiction and Animation and €30k for Doc, Short and XR categories, up to 50% of the expenses borne.

Those submitting requests for grants must outline a minimum eligible spend in the Veneto Region of €200k for projects in the Fiction and Animation categories and €20k in the Doc, Short and XR (Extended Reality): VR (Virtual Reality), AR (Augmented Reality), MR (Mixed Reality) categories.
